In a power plant the noise produced by the machinery is: Steam turbine 92 dB, generator 76 dB, pumps 72 dB. If all machines are running continuously, calculate the reduction in sound pressure level in dB that would result if the steam turbine is covered with a special soundproof enclosure so that people can work in this area without personal hearing protectors for 4 hours a day.
